Implementing Sustainable Drainage Systems (SuDS)
Sustainable Drainage Systems (SuDS) are designed to mimic natural water processes, reducing runoff and improving water quality. In Haywards Heath, implementing SuDS can help manage water more effectively, reducing the risk of flooding and enhancing the environment. These systems include features like permeable pavements, green roofs, and rain gardens.

Enhancing Water Quality
Effective drainage systems can improve water quality by filtering pollutants and reducing runoff. In Haywards Heath, implementing features like vegetated swales and retention ponds can help remove contaminants from water, benefiting both the environment and public health.
Supporting Biodiversity
Sustainable drainage solutions can create habitats for wildlife, supporting biodiversity in urban areas. In Haywards Heath, features like rain gardens and green roofs can provide valuable habitats for birds, insects, and plants, enhancing the town's ecological richness.
